Question 693164: Can you solve
6.02*10^23
I tried to on my calculator but it comes out with an e.

Found 2 solutions by jim_thompson5910, josmiceli:
Answer by jim_thompson5910(35256)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
6.02*10^23 = 602,000,000,000,000,000,000,000

Note: there are 21 zeros after the "602"
